Soda Ash Market of Middle East/North Africa (MENA)
Overview of the Soda Ash Market in MENA The Soda Ash Market in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region is witnessing a significant transformation, marked by increasing industrial demand, infrastructure expansion, and rising consumer needs. Soda ash, also known as sodium carbonate (Na?CO?), is a vital raw material used across diverse sectors such as glass manufacturing, detergents, chemicals, water treatment, and pulp & paper. The strategic geographic positioning of MENA countries, paired with rich natural resources and industrialization, has turned the region into a lucrative zone for soda ash production and consumption. Current Trends Shaping the MENA Soda Ash Market 1. Industrialization and Urban Development Rapid industrial growth and urbanization in nations like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, Egypt, and Morocco are driving the demand for construction materials and glass products. As soda ash is a critical component in the glass manufacturing process, this surge in demand is directly influencing the soda ash market positively. Additionally, infrastructure megaprojects such as NEOM in Saudi Arabia and New Administrative Capital in Egypt further bolster consumption. 2. Increased Demand in Detergents and Household Products With rising awareness of hygiene and health across the region, there is a notable increase in the demand for soaps, detergents, and household cleaners. Soda ash serves as a builder and pH regulator in detergent formulations, making it indispensable for manufacturers. The expanding middle-class population and higher disposable income levels are reinforcing this upward trajectory. 3. Strategic Government Initiatives and Investments Governments across MENA are actively supporting industrial development through Vision 2030 (Saudi Arabia), UAE Industrial Strategy 2031, and similar initiatives, which aim to diversify economies beyond oil. This strategic pivot is catalyzing growth in the chemicals and materials sectors, where soda ash plays a foundational role. Production Landscape and Supply Chain Dynamics 1. Key Producers and Market Players The MENA region, though not a major global producer of natural soda ash, is increasingly focusing on synthetic soda ash production due to the scarcity of natural trona deposits. However, countries like Egypt and Algeria have developed robust synthetic soda ash plants. Leading players involved in the region’s supply include: OCI N.V. Qatar Industrial Manufacturing Company Tata Chemicals Europe (regional partnerships) CIECH Group (logistics collaborations) 2. Import-Export Dependencies MENA countries, particularly the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) states, heavily rely on imports from the US, China, and Turkey to meet domestic demand. However, there is a noticeable shift towards local production to reduce dependency and improve supply chain resilience. Port infrastructure in Jebel Ali (UAE), Dammam (Saudi Arabia), and Port Said (Egypt) play crucial roles in enabling bulk soda ash imports and regional redistribution. Applications and End-Use Industries in MENA 1. Glass Manufacturing The glass industry is the largest consumer of soda ash, accounting for over 50% of total demand. The MENA region is witnessing a rise in: Architectural glass for modern buildings Container glass for food and beverage packaging Solar panel glass driven by clean energy initiatives With regional ambitions to become renewable energy leaders, demand for solar glass is especially gaining momentum. 2. Chemical Manufacturing Soda ash is essential in the production of various chemicals like sodium silicates, sodium bicarbonate, and percarbonates. As chemical parks and industrial zones expand in the region, especially in KIZAD (UAE) and Yanbu Industrial City (Saudi Arabia), consumption of soda ash in chemical synthesis continues to rise. 3. Water Treatment and Environmental Applications Governments in MENA are investing heavily in water desalination and treatment projects. Soda ash is used in the softening of water, pH adjustment, and removal of heavy metals. The expansion of municipal water systems and industrial wastewater treatment plants is a key driver of demand in this sector. Market Challenges and Opportunities 1. Environmental Concerns and Sustainability The soda ash production process, especially synthetic variants, can be energy-intensive and environmentally taxing. There is mounting pressure on manufacturers to adopt greener technologies and circular economy practices. The introduction of carbon capture systems and zero-liquid discharge (ZLD) in manufacturing units are positive developments in this direction. 2. Competitive Landscape and Pricing Volatility Global market fluctuations in energy and transportation costs can impact soda ash pricing in the MENA region. However, the development of regional free trade agreements, such as the Greater Arab Free Trade Area (GAFTA), provides a buffer against some of these volatilities by easing cross-border trade and improving supply chain efficiency. 3. Investment in R&D and Innovation The region is gradually investing in R&D to enhance process efficiency and product quality. Universities and private firms are collaborating to explore alternative raw materials and cleaner synthesis methods, which will shape the future competitiveness of local soda ash producers. Future Outlook of the Soda Ash Market in MENA The MENA soda ash market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 4.5% to 6.2% over the next five years, driven by construction booms, industrial expansion, and sustainability goals. Countries like Saudi Arabia, UAE, Egypt, and Morocco are poised to become regional powerhouses in soda ash consumption, with ambitions to localize more of the supply chain. Key future developments include: Establishment of local soda ash manufacturing units Integration of renewable energy sources in production processes Expansion of industrial ports and logistical capabilities Public-private partnerships for chemical sector growth Conclusion The Soda Ash Market in the MENA region is undergoing a pivotal shift, driven by industrial dynamism, government backing, and evolving end-use applications. While challenges like environmental impact and import dependence remain, the long-term trajectory points toward sustained growth, localization, and innovation. With strategic investments and market-driven policies, the MENA region is well-positioned to enhance its presence in the global soda ash landscape. What Are Some Chemicals Not Manufactured In India?
India’s chemical industry is rapidly growing, producing a wide range of basic and specialty chemicals to meet both domestic and international demand. However, despite this significant progress, some Chemicals Not Manufactured In India and compounds remain either unmanufactured or produced in very limited quantities in India. Understanding what chemicals India does not manufacture highlights gaps in the country’s chemical manufacturing ecosystem and reveals opportunities for future growth. Why Some Chemicals Are Not Manufactured Locally Several reasons explain why certain chemicals are not manufactured in India. High investment costs, technological complexity, regulatory challenges, or insufficient domestic demand can limit production. Additionally, some chemicals require rare raw materials or specialized manufacturing conditions that are currently unavailable or uneconomical to replicate in India. These chemicals require advanced technology and strict quality control, making their local production difficult. Many Indian manufacturers rely on imports to fulfill the needs of industries like electronics, pharmaceuticals, and aerospace.
